Abstract

The utility model relates to a mosquito-repellent curtain fabric, which comprises a high-density fabric composite layer and waterproof moisture-permeable surface layers on two sides of the high-density fabric composite layer, wherein the high-density fabric composite layer comprises a main fabric layer and mosquito-repellent microcapsules loaded on the main fabric layer; the mosquito-repellent microcapsule is of a core-shell structure and comprises an outer shell and a mosquito-repellent inner core, wherein the outer shell is provided with a micropore channel which is communicated with the inside and the outside; the high-density fabric composite layer is connected with the waterproof moisture-permeable surface layers on the two sides of the high-density fabric composite layer through bonding layers respectively; a tem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er is arranged outside the at least one waterproof moisture permeable surface layer. The shell of the mosquito-repellent microcapsule prevents the loss of the mosquito-repellent inner core, the wa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er protects the mosquito-repellent microcapsule from falling off, and the double protection mechanism endows the curtain fabric with a long-term effective mosquito-repellent effect; in addition, the tem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er changes the color of the tem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er into the color which is offensive to mosquitoes in seasons with the change of the environment temperature, and the tem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er and the mosquito repellent inner core cooperatively repel mosquitoes; moreover, the experience feeling brought by the color change is good.

Background
Curtain cloth is used in a large number in life, and besides shading and blocking ultraviolet rays, various functions are continuously developed, for example: patent document No. CN209756345U discloses a curtain fabric with antibacterial and deodorant functions, and patent document No. CN108784262A discloses a sun-proof curtain fabric.
In hot summer, mosquito abuse is accompanied by disease spreading, and curtain cloth for expelling mosquito is developed. Patent document with publication number CN209135220U discloses a curtain cloth with mosquito repellent function, which comprises a first base cloth layer, a waterproof layer and a second base cloth layer, which are sequentially arranged from outside to inside, wherein the second base cloth layer is used for spraying a mosquito repellent amine spray to the second base cloth layer, the waterproof layer is used for isolating the mosquito repellent amine spray from the first base cloth layer, the mosquito repellent amine spray can be sprayed on the second base cloth layer during use, so that a good mosquito repellent effect is achieved, the mosquito repellent amine spray can be effectively isolated through the waterproof layer, and the first base cloth layer is prevented from fading. However, the spraying of the DEET is required to be carried out every time of use, which is inconvenient.
Therefore, there is a need in the art to develop a novel mosquito repellent curtain fabric.

Detailed Description
In order to more clearly illustrate the embodiments of the present invention, the following description will explain embodiments of the present invention with reference to the accompanying drawings. It is obvious that the drawings in the following description are only examples of the invention, and that for a person skilled in the art, other drawings and embodiments can be obtained from these drawings without inventive effort.
Example 1:
as shown in fig. 1 to 3, the mosquito repellent curtain fabric of the present embodiment includes a high-density fabric composite layer 1, an upper wa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 2 and a lower wa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 3 on upper and lower sides thereof, and further includes an upper temperature-control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 6 attached to the upper wa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 2 and a lower temperature-control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 7 attached to the lower wa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 3; the first high-density fabric composite layer 1 is connected with the upper wa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 2 in an adhesive way through an upper bonding layer 4, and the high-density fabric composite layer 1 is connected with the lower wa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 3 in an adhesive way through a lower bonding layer 5. In addition, the upper waterproof moisture permeable surface layer 2 and the upper tem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 6 can also be bonded by adopting a bonding agent, and the lower waterproof moisture permeable surface layer 3 and the lower tem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 7 can also be bonded by adopting a bonding agent.
The high-density fabric composite layer 1 of the present embodiment includes a main fabric layer and mosquito-repellent microcapsules 10 loaded on the main fabric layer. Specifically, the main fabric layer is a main body of the curtain fabric and is formed by crosswise weaving warps and wefts, and the main fabric layer is crosswise woven and has enough surface area to provide a loading site for the mosquito-repellent microcapsules 10. The mosquito-repellent microcapsules 10 loaded on one warp yarn of the main fabric layer are exemplified, and as shown in fig. 2, the mosquito-repellent microcapsules 10 are uniformly loaded on the warp yarn. In addition, the mosquito-repellent microcapsules are dispersed in an aqueous phase and loaded onto the main fabric layer by impregnation.
As shown in fig. 3, the mosquito-repellent microcapsule 10 is a core-shell structure, and includes a shell 10a and a mosquito-repellent inner core 10b, and the mosquito-repellent inner core can be separated from the external environment by the microcapsule technology, so that the mosquito-repellent inner core stably exists in the space environment in the shell, and the problems of loss of the mosquito-repellent inner core caused by external environment change or reaction with external foreign matters and the like are avoided.
The mosquito repelling inner core 10b is made of a mosquito repelling agent of mozzie buster, geranium or lavender, namely an extract of the mozzie buster, the geranium or the lavender, adopts a natural mosquito repelling agent, and is non-toxic and environment-friendly. The loading capacity of the mosquito-repellent microcapsules in the high-density fabric composite layer is 5%, in addition, the specific loading capacity can be adjusted according to the requirements of application occasions, and the loading capacity of the mosquito-repellent microcapsules in the high-density fabric composite layer is set within the range of 1-15%.
The shell 10a is spherical, and the diameter of the shell is 2-20 mu m; the shell 10a is provided with an internal and external communicated micropore channel, which can prevent the loss of the mosquito repelling inner core and ensure that the mosquito repelling components emitted by the mosquito repelling inner core can overflow. The material of the case 10a is preferably polypropylene.
The upper wa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 2 and the lower wa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 3 of the embodiment both adopt waterproof moisture-permeable fabrics, so that the diffused mosquito-repellent ingredients can overflow through the upper wa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 2 and the lower waterproof moisture-permeable surface layer 3, the water resistance of the curtain fabric can be realized, and the dropping of the mosquito-repellent microcapsules can be protected.
The upper tem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 6 and the lower tem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er 7 on the two sides of the mosquito repellent curtain fabric are both temperature-changing pigments, and the color of the tem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er is changed into a color which is offensive to mosquitoes in seasons with the change of the environmental temperature, so that the temperature control color-changing mosquito repellent layer and the mosquito repellent inner core cooperatively repel mosquitoes; moreover, the experience feeling brought by the color change is good.
In the embodiment, the mosquito is dispersed by the natural mosquito-repellent component emitted by the mosquito-repellent inner core of the mosquito-repellent microcapsule in the mosquito-repellent curtain cloth and the color change of the temperature-control discoloring mosquito-repellent layer in a synergistic manner, and meanwhile, the living environment is improved; the shell of the mosquito-repellent microcapsule protects the loss of the mosquito-repellent inner core, and the waterproof moisture-permeable surface layers on the two sides protect the dropping of the mosquito-repellent microcapsule and are beneficial to the dispersion of mosquito-repellent components.
